The decrease of oxygen content and crack in oxygen-free copper ingots were analyzed. Firstly
through the development of an integrated holding temperature smelting furnace
the holding temperature and melting process were integrated into the whole. Therefore
the traditional three-stage fabrication method of alloy copper was modified into a two-stage fabrication method of holding smelting and drawing casting of anaerobic copper. Secondly
the gate valve technology of controlling melt flow and stopping was proposed and realized. Thirdly
the crack of anaerobic copper ingot with width/thickness ratio of 650 mm/20 mm was analyzed. Finally
